Dengue fever

Featured Replies

I am currently recovering from Dengue, values all going up again. The most annoying thing is the itcht rash and the swollen hands. At the hospital they told me there is no remedy for the rash, just need to wait it out. Anybody has any idea how to allievate the rush?

 

Thanks in advance

An antihistamine tablet or lotion may help with the itching.

I'd start with lotion e.g one containing diphenhydramine. There are many brands, often combining this with calamine lotion.

If no relief then I'd probably try tablet. Loratadine if you want to avoid drowsiness, HYdroxyzine if you want help sleeping.

These are all OTC and any pharmacy has them.
